 E9: Black Lives Matter Activist Defends His Provocative Tactics |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 30:59

Asa Khalif, who now heads Coalition for Black Lives, talks about how his aggressive and sometimes profane behavior has caused him to get arrested (several times) and created discomfort even amongst other Black Lives Matter supporters. You will recognize Khalif for his protests after the controversial arrests at a Center City Starbucks. He also discusses being raised by a white father, how racism persists in an American society that obsesses over black culture, whether he is anti-police and if black-on-black crime is a more important issue than police aggression.  Episode 7: Dirty Harry Shows His Soft Side |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 29:40

Michael Chitwood, who leads the Upper Darby Police Department, talks to Matt O'Donnell about the heartbreaking incident that convinced him to temporarily stop carrying a gun on the job, plus Black Lives Matter, "emotional intelligence" in policing, the opioid epidemic, Ira Einhorn, the Ferguson Effect, school shootings, and of course the Clint Eastwood movies that inspired his nickname.
